Transaction 16b75a93a79d819d333546cc10b3486d1da183b3bd57f72f2f3b6af507780226
4 Input
2 Outputs
- 16b75a93a79d819d333546cc10b3486d1da183b3bd57f72f2f3b6af507780226:0
- 16b75a93a79d819d333546cc10b3486d1da183b3bd57f72f2f3b6af507780226:1
value 61015000
address 3GoErHzRbPzQ32TkUQiYqa6VSW7iBFes2U
value 18013882
address 3BMEXw1KauVH61AsEXYTtM4CcviW5Gk2PA